About the role
Responsibilities
- Administer compliance with the safety program and lead accident prevention efforts
- Conduct site inspections of project work areas and equipment
- Develop, organize, and implement safety related programs
- Assist in accident investigations and determine root causes
- Perform and document jobsite inspections and audits focusing on hazard recognition
- Coordinate and conduct safety meetings and training programs
- Participate in regulatory agency inspections and investigations
Requirements
- Minimum of 5 years of construction safety experience
- Experience with bridge and roadway projects
- Experience in heavy civil, infrastructure, tunnel, or transportation projects
- Bachelor's degree in Occupational Safety, EHS, or a related field
- Or a nationally recognized safety certification (CHST, OHST, STS, STSC, or BCSP credential)
- Strong knowledge of OSHA construction regulations
- Ability to work night shift and overtime
- Physical ability to stand, walk, and climb multiple flights of stairs
